Cape Town estate agent receives international accolade

Cape Town - Gerlinde Moser, broker/owner of RE/MAX Living in Cape Town’s City Bowl and Atlantic Seaboard is the first real estate professional within Southern Africa to be awarded the Luminary of Distinction, the highest distinction of three career awards given by RE/MAX International.
She is one of only two people outside of North America and Canada to receive the award.
 
The career requirements of the award include a minimum of 20 years’ service with RE/MAX.

Associates who receive the award must also have already received both a Hall of Fame and Lifetime Achievement awards. Currently, only 55 people in the world have received the award, a mere 0.05% of the over 100 000 strong RE/MAX network around the globe.

Adrian Goslett, regional director and CEO of RE/MAX of Southern Africa, describes Moser’s achievement as remarkable.

While she had been a successful real estate business owner in her own right, Gerlinde encountered the RE/MAX brand in the US on her travels around the world.

Coming from a more traditional real estate setup, she liked the different type of business model the brand offered real estate professionals – one of the first of its kind in the industry.

When the brand finally made it to South African shores in 1995, Moser became one of the first to join as a founding broker/owner.
 
“The RE/MAX brand had an international presence that could be used as a tool to enhance my business - from Alaska to China and from South Africa to Vienna," said Moser.

"As a business owner in this industry, it is also rewarding to see my agents be successful in a profession that is highly demanding.”
 
Outside of her real estate endeavours, Moser promotes the importance of the community building philosophy.
